Output 3c161bc9e8809219a37ecf9ecd7cbb96becd2b99840470027ac65dbe8099ede6:2

value
309140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 189b1e2b8f675c536da9df8c6feff529d9793416 OP_EQUALVERIFY OP_CHECKSIG
address
13F73P7WjoeYUCF2vDNDUDxxtvSJvJzcUu
transaction
3c161bc9e8809219a37ecf9ecd7cbb96becd2b99840470027ac65dbe8099ede6
spent
true